Infinix Note 12i Launched: A Premium Smartphone Experience

The Infinix Note 12i is a powerful and feature-packed smartphone that offers an exceptional display, powerful performance, smooth user interface, versatile camera, and sleek design. It's an ideal device for those who demand a premium experience from their mobile device.

Exceptional Display

The Infinix Note 12i boasts an impressive 6.7-inch Full HD+ AMOLED screen with a 60Hz refresh rate, 180Hz touch sampling rate, and a 108% NTSC Ratio. The screen also has a 100% DCI P3 color gamut and a maximum brightness of 1000 nits, making it perfect for streaming videos, browsing the web, and playing games. The screen also has a 92% screen-to-body ratio, protected by Corning Gorilla Glass 3.

Powerful Performance

Under the hood, the Note 12i is powered by an Octa Core MediaTek Helio G85 12nm processor, which consists of Dual 2GHz Cortex-A75 and Hexa 2GHz 6x Cortex-A55 CPUs. This processor is coupled with an ARM Mali-G52 2EEMC2 GPU that runs at up to 1000MHz, ensuring smooth performance and efficient power usage. The device comes with 4GB LPPDDR4x RAM and 64GB (eMMC 5.1) storage, which can be expanded up to 512GB with a microSD card, allowing you to store more files, apps, and media.

Smooth User Interface

The Note 12i runs on Android 12 with XOS 12, which offers a smooth and personalized user experience. The new version of XOS 12 is more intuitive and user-friendly, making it easier to navigate and customize your device.

Versatile Camera and Features

The Note 12i also has a dual-SIM capability, allowing you to use two different numbers on the same device. The rear camera features a 50MP sensor with an f/1.6 aperture, quad-LED flash, 2MP depth sensor, and a QVGA AI lens. The front camera is an 8MP sensor, perfect for taking selfies and video calls. Other features of the Note 12i include a side-mounted fingerprint sensor, a 3.5mm audio jack, and stereo speakers.

Sleek Design and Connectivity

The device measures 164.43 x 76.6 x 8.03mm and weighs 188g. It offers connectivity options such as Dual 4G VoLTE, Wi-Fi 802.11 ac (2.4GHz + 5GHz), Bluetooth 5, GPS + GLONASS, and USB Type-C. The device is powered by a 5000mAh (typical) battery with 33W fast charging, ensuring that you have enough power to last throughout the day.

Infinix Note 12i Specifications

Display 6.7-inch (2400 × 1080 pixels) Full HD+ AMOLED screen with 60Hz refresh rate, 180Hz touch sampling rate, 108% NTSC Ratio and 100% DCI P3 color gamut, up to 1000 nits brightness, 92% Screen-to-Body Ratio, Corning Gorilla Glass 3 Protection
Processor Octa Core MediaTek Helio G85 12nm processor (Dual 2GHz Cortex-A75 + Hexa 2GHz 6x Cortex-A55 CPUs) with up to 1000MHz ARM Mali-G52 2EEMC2 GPU
RAM/Storage 4GB LPPDDR4x RAM, 64GB (eMMC 5.1) storage, expandable memory up to 512GB with microSD
OS/UI Android 12 with XOS 12
SIM Dual SIM (nano + nano + microSD)
Rear Cameras 50MP rear camera with f/1.6 aperture, quad-LED flash, 2MP depth sensor, QVGA AI lens
Front Camera 8MP front camera
Features Side-mounted fingerprint sensor, 3.5mm audio jack, stereo speakers
Dimensions  164.43 x 76.6 x 8.03mm
Weight 188g
Connectivity Dual 4G VoLTE, Wi-Fi 802.11 ac (2.4GHz + 5GHz), Bluetooth 5, GPS + GLONASS, USB Type-C
Battery/Charger 5000mAh (typical) battery with 33W fast charging

The Infinix Note 12i is a stylish and powerful smartphone that comes in two sleek and modern color options: Force Black and Metaverse Blue. These colors give the device a premium and sophisticated look that is sure to turn heads. The device is set to be available for purchase starting January 30th, and will be exclusively available on Flipkart. The introductory price for the device is Rs. 9999 for the 4GB RAM and 64GB storage variant, making it an affordable and attractive option for those looking for a high-performance device at a reasonable price.
